What to Consider When Buying Waterfront Property
Buying a waterfront home is different from buying a regular property. Here are some important factors to consider:
Waterfront Regulations and Permits
Waterfront properties often come with specific regulations and permit requirements. These may include restrictions on building, landscaping, and water usage. Before making an offer, research the local regulations and ensure that you understand your responsibilities as a waterfront homeowner. Consult with local authorities or a real estate attorney to get clarification on any rules or permits that may apply.
Flood Insurance
Waterfront homes are more susceptible to flooding, so flood insurance is essential. Your mortgage lender will likely require you to have flood insurance if the property is located in a designated flood zone. Even if it's not required, it's a good idea to have it for peace of mind. The cost of flood insurance can vary depending on the property's location and elevation. Get quotes from multiple insurance providers to find the best rate.
Shoreline Maintenance
Maintaining the shoreline is crucial for protecting your property and the environment. Erosion can damage your property and pollute the lake. Take steps to prevent erosion, such as planting native vegetation, building retaining walls, or installing riprap. Regularly inspect the shoreline for signs of erosion and address any issues promptly. Proper shoreline maintenance will help preserve the value of your property and protect the natural beauty of Lake Marion.

Amenities and Conveniences
While Lake Marion offers a peaceful retreat, it's also conveniently located near amenities and conveniences. The towns of Santee, Summerton, and Manning are all within a short drive, offering grocery stores, restaurants, and other essential services. Larger cities like Columbia and Charleston are also within driving distance, providing access to major shopping centers, hospitals, and cultural attractions. Mortgage Options
Explore different mortgage options to find the one that best suits your needs. Conventional mortgages, FHA loans, and VA loans are all possibilities. Conventional mortgages typically require a larger down payment but may offer lower interest rates. FHA loans are insured by the Federal Housing Administration and are often easier to qualify for, but they require mortgage insurance. VA loans are available to veterans and active-duty military personnel and offer favorable terms. Shop around and compare rates from different lenders to find the best deal.

Credit Score and Debt-to-Income Ratio
Your credit score and debt-to-income ratio will play a significant role in your ability to get a mortgage. Lenders will look at your credit score to assess your creditworthiness. A higher credit score will increase your chances of getting approved for a loan and may also qualify you for a lower interest rate. Your debt-to-income ratio is the percentage of your monthly income that goes towards debt payments. Lenders prefer a lower debt-to-income ratio, as it indicates that you have more disposable income and are less likely to default on your loan. Improve your credit score and reduce your debt-to-income ratio before applying for a mortgage to increase your chances of approval.
